The sheer audacity is jaw dropping, the delivery magnificent and the end result ultimately glorious.

John Stones, just having turned 19 years old, was stepping up to take a penalty. For context, this was his first game for Everton, albeit in a pre-season friendly against Juventus.

Nevertheless, it shows how far English centre-halves have come over the years when it can be reported, as verified by YouTube, that Stones chipped his only penalty Panenka-style over the goalkeeper and into the top corner, just as Antonin Panenka did to win the 1976 Euros for Czechoslovakia.
